Aga Rangemaster sold to U.S MIddleby Corporation

Despite a last-minute bid for Aga Rangemaster, Whirlpool is not buying the group as shareholders agreed a $201million takeover by Middleby Corporation, according to Reuters.

Whirlpool confirmed a non-binding bid for Aga Rangemaster last week, at the IFA exhibition which challenged the offer of the U.S cooking equipment manufacturer Middleby Corporation, agreed in principle in July.

The sale includes all Aga Group kitchen appliance brands of Aga Rangemaster, Mercury, Falcon, Marvel, Stanley and La Cornue.

Based at Leamington Spa, Aga Group has more than 2,500 employees worldwide.
